About this House

Available 8/1/2026 - *Student Housing*Welcome to 427 E Lincoln Avenue in Salisbury, MD! This spacious 4-bedroom, 2-bath home combines modern updates with classic charm. The kitchen features stainless steel appliancesincluding a refrigerator, dishwasher, and rangeplus plenty of counter and cabinet space. Enjoy the convenience of an in-unit washer and dryer, central air conditioning, and efficient natural gas heat.Step outside to a private deck, perfect for relaxing or entertaining. Off-street parking is available, and the home sits just about one mile from Salisbury University, shopping, and restaurants.Don't miss the opportunity to make 427 E Lincoln Avenue your next home!
427 E Lincoln Ave, Salisbury, MD 21804 is a 4 bedroom, 2 bathroom, 1,873 sqft single-family home built in 1900. It last sold for $44,900 on Jul 21, 1988 (1,852% above the $2,300 asking price). More recently, it was listed as a rental in January 2026 with an asking price of $2,300 per month. That rental listing was removed on January 23, 2026. This property is not currently displayed as for sale or rent on Trulia. The Trulia Estimate is $226,500, with a rent estimate of $1,795/month.
